Sunrise of Troy is a senior living community centrally situated in a prime location in Troy, Michigan. The community is designed to inspire residents to focus on their wellness, find joy, and make the most of each day alongside good friends and neighbors, with room rates starting at $4,074 per month. At Sunrise of Troy, the team values individuality and works to gain a deep understanding of each resident’s needs, preferences, and goals, using this knowledge to develop customized care plans that influence the use of services and programs. Sunrise of Troy’s tenured and compassionate caregivers are proud members of the Sunrise community, dedicated to meeting residents’ health and wellness needs and helping them find authentic joy in everyday beauty and possibilities.

The community offers a variety of engaging activities, such as spiritual exploration, musical performances, crafting, and popcorn taste tests, while the dining experience allows residents to enjoy their meals as they please. Sunrise of Troy is one of the top fundraising performers for the Alzheimer’s Association, a testament to its commitment to compassionate memory care. Located in the heart of Metropolitan Detroit’s northern suburbs and a shopping hub, the community is conveniently situated on Crooks Road, close to I-75, Somerset Mall, and several hospitals, making it an ideal choice for seniors seeking a vibrant and supportive living environment.

What government services provide money for senior housing?

Several government programs offer financial assistance for senior housing in various countries, focusing on the United States for a broad overview:

  • Medicaid: Medicaid is a state and federally funded program that can cover the costs of nursing home care for those who meet eligibility criteria, including income and asset limits. Some states also offer Medicaid waivers that help pay for home and community-based services to prevent or delay nursing home placement.
  • Medicare: Medicare, primarily a health insurance program for people aged 65 and over, does not cover long-term housing costs. However, it can cover short-term stays in a skilled nursing facility under specific conditions following a hospital stay.
  • Section 202 Supportive Housing for the Elderly Program: This program provides housing for low-income seniors. It offers rental assistance and access to supportive services, such as cleaning, cooking, and transportation.
  • Low-Income Housing Tax Credit (LIHTC) Properties: While not a direct subsidy, LIHTC encourages developers to create affordable housing. Seniors with low incomes can find reduced-rent apartments through this program.
  • State and Local Programs: Many states, counties, and cities offer their own programs to assist seniors with housing costs. These can include property tax relief programs, rental assistance programs, and programs that offer affordable senior housing options.
  • Veterans Affairs (VA): The VA offers several programs for veterans, including the Aid and Attendance benefit, which provides monthly payments to veterans who require the aid of another person, or are housebound, to help cover the cost of care in homes, nursing homes, and assisted living facilities.
  • Social Security: While Social Security primarily provides retirement income, for many seniors, these benefits are a crucial part of their budget, including housing costs.
